If anyone has any objections, please let me know. ------------------ From: Abdun Nihaal [ Upstream commit 46a499aaf8c27476fd05e800f3e947bfd71aa724 ] In efx_mae_enumerate_mports(), memory allocated for mae_mport_desc is passed as a argument to efx_mae_process_mport(), but when the error path in efx_mae_process_mport() gets executed, the memory allocated for desc gets leaked. Fix that by freeing the memory allocation before returning error.
